> One other thing:  Look at your wikka.config.php 'wakka_version'.  It
> should be set to 1.2.  Then look at wikka.php and search for
> WAKKA_VERSION; it should be set to 1.2 as well.  If they're not, then
> you're going to continue to have issues until both match.
